The Dean of the College of Information Technology held a meeting with college faculty to discuss academic publishing and the distribution of tasks for the international conference.
The Dean of the College of Information Technology, Professor Dr. Manar Younis Kashmula, chaired a meeting with college faculty members, in the presence of members of the College Council. The meeting discussed several academic and organizational topics.
The meeting’s topics were as follows:
1. Academic Publishing: The Dean urged faculty members to enhance their efforts in publishing sound academic research, which would contribute to raising the academic and research standing of the college and university.
2. Directives from the Ministry and the University Presidency: Emphasizing adherence to the instructions of the Ministry of Higher Education and the University of Nineveh Presidency regarding student attendance and the start of the new academic year 2025-2026.
3. International Conference: Announcing the college’s participation, in cooperation with the College of Electronics Engineering, in organizing an international conference. During the meeting, the distribution of tasks and committees among faculty members was discussed to ensure the success of the conference.
4. Academic Promotions: Discussing the obstacles facing faculty members regarding academic promotions and seeking practical solutions to overcome them.
At the conclusion of the meeting, the Dean affirmed her commitment to supporting faculty members and affiliates, praising their efforts in serving the academic process and enhancing the college’s standing.
